
White cabinets are a staple in classic kitchen design. They create a clean, bright look that can make any space feel larger and more inviting. Pair white cabinets with contrasting dark countertops for a striking effect, or opt for lighter shades to maintain a soft, cohesive look. This combination works well with various design styles, from farmhouse to contemporary.
Marble countertops exude luxury and sophistication, making them a perfect choice for a classic kitchen remodel. Their natural veining adds character and elegance, ensuring that each countertop is unique. While marble requires some maintenance, its beauty and timelessness make it a popular choice among homeowners.
Subway tiles are a go-to choice for backsplashes in classic kitchens. Their simple rectangular shape and clean lines create a timeless look that pairs well with almost any cabinet style. Consider traditional white tiles for a crisp finish or colored options for a pop of personality. Subway tiles are easy to clean and maintain, adding to their enduring appeal.
A farmhouse sink, or apron-front sink, is a classic element that adds charm to any kitchen. This type of sink is not only functional but also serves as a statement piece. Available in various materials, including fireclay, stainless steel, and cast iron, a farmhouse sink brings a warm, inviting touch to the heart of your home.
Choosing classic hardware can significantly enhance your kitchen’s overall design. Opt for brushed nickel, oil-rubbed bronze, or polished brass finishes for cabinet handles and faucets. These timeless materials add character without overwhelming the space, ensuring your kitchen remains stylish for years to come.
Incorporating pendant lighting can provide both functionality and style in a classic kitchen. Hanging fixtures above the kitchen island or dining area can serve as focal points. Choose designs that reflect classic styles, such as lanterns or glass globes, to maintain a cohesive look throughout the space.
Open shelving is not only functional but also adds an element of design to a classic kitchen. Display your favorite dishware, cookbooks, or decorative items on open shelves. This approach makes the space feel more personalized while keeping essentials within easy reach.
Incorporating warm wood accents can enhance the classic appeal of your kitchen. Whether it’s wooden beams, cabinetry, or flooring, wood adds warmth and texture. Consider using reclaimed wood for a rustic look or polished hardwood for a more refined appearance.
Sticking to classic color palettes can help maintain a timeless aesthetic in your kitchen. Neutral tones, soft pastels, and deep jewel tones are excellent choices. Pair these colors with white or cream accents to create a cohesive, elegant look that remains stylish over time.
